Sufi Wins On Last Day At Kentucky Fall Classic

Oct. 5, 2003

WEST LAFAYETTE, Ind. - The Purdue women's tennis team concluded play at the Kentucky Fall Classic in Lexington, on Sunday.

Freshman Hala Sufi was the lone Boilermaker winner on the day, with a 6-1, 6-3 victory over the Wildcats' Danielle Petrisko in the Blue flight.

Also in the Blue flight, junior Shawna Zuccarini dropped a 7-5, 6-0 decision to Ohio State's Lindsay Williams. Sophomore Paula Schmidt lost 6-1, 6-3 to Abilene Christian's Lauren Yarbrough in the Red flight, while freshman Emily Bomersback lost 6-1, 3-6, 6-0 to Marshall's Meghan Skalsky in the Green flight. Freshman Alyssa Rodriguez fell 3-6, 6-4, 6-3 to Notre Dame's Christian Thompson in the White flight.

The Boilermakers will return to action Oct. 23, when the ITA Regional Championships begin in Kalamazoo, Mich.
